This Executive Certificate in Content Creation for Online Safety Education equips participants with the skills to develop engaging and effective content for digital safety initiatives. The program focuses on creating materials that are both informative and appealing to diverse audiences, crucial for impactful online safety education.
Learning outcomes include mastering various content formats (videos, infographics, blog posts, social media campaigns), understanding child online safety best practices, and developing strategies for effective audience engagement. You’ll gain proficiency in digital literacy skills and online safety awareness, essential for today’s digital landscape.
The program's duration is typically 6-8 weeks, delivered through a flexible online learning environment. This allows professionals to upskill conveniently without disrupting their current commitments. The curriculum is regularly updated to reflect the ever-evolving online safety challenges and best practices.
